本文目录导读:
图片来源于网络,如有侵权联系删除
随着互联网技术的飞速发展,数据库已经成为各类企业、机构的核心资产,为了确保数据的一致性和可靠性,数据库同步工具应运而生,本文将全面解析数据库同步工具的种类、功能与优势,帮助您选择适合自己需求的同步工具。
数据库同步工具的种类
1、同步软件
同步软件是数据库同步工具中最常见的一种,如MySQL Workbench、SQL Server Management Studio等,这些软件具有图形化界面,操作简单,适合初学者使用。
2、同步脚本
同步脚本是通过编写SQL语句或脚本语言实现数据库同步的工具,如PL/SQL、T-SQL等,这种工具适用于对数据库结构有深入了解的用户,可以实现复杂的同步需求。
3、同步插件
同步插件是集成在其他软件中的数据库同步功能,如Eclipse Data Tools Platform (DTP)、Visual Studio插件等,这些插件可以方便地与其他开发工具结合使用,提高开发效率。
4、云数据库同步工具
云数据库同步工具是指基于云计算平台的数据库同步工具,如阿里云RDS、腾讯云数据库等,这种工具具有高可用性、可扩展性等特点,适合大规模数据库同步需求。
数据库同步工具的功能
1、数据同步
数据同步是数据库同步工具的核心功能,可以实现不同数据库之间的数据同步,如MySQL到Oracle、SQL Server到MySQL等。
图片来源于网络,如有侵权联系删除
2、结构同步
结构同步是指同步数据库结构,包括表、视图、存储过程等,这种功能可以确保不同数据库之间的结构一致性。
3、数据迁移
数据迁移是指将数据从一种数据库迁移到另一种数据库,如从MySQL迁移到SQL Server,数据迁移工具可以实现数据迁移过程中的数据转换、清洗等功能。
4、备份与恢复
备份与恢复是数据库同步工具的重要功能,可以保证数据库数据的安全性,备份功能可以将数据库数据备份到本地或远程存储,恢复功能可以在数据丢失或损坏时恢复数据。
5、监控与报警
数据库同步工具具有监控功能,可以实时监控数据库同步状态,如同步进度、同步错误等,工具还支持设置报警机制,当同步出现问题时及时通知用户。
数据库同步工具的优势
1、提高效率
数据库同步工具可以自动化数据库同步过程,提高工作效率,降低人工操作成本。
2、保证数据一致性
图片来源于网络,如有侵权联系删除
通过同步工具,可以确保不同数据库之间的数据一致性,降低数据错误的风险。
3、适应性强
数据库同步工具支持多种数据库类型,可以满足不同业务场景的需求。
4、灵活性高
同步工具提供丰富的功能,可以根据实际需求进行定制化配置,满足不同用户的个性化需求。
5、安全可靠
数据库同步工具具有完善的备份与恢复机制,确保数据安全性。
数据库同步工具在保证数据一致性、提高工作效率等方面发挥着重要作用,本文从种类、功能、优势等方面对数据库同步工具进行了全面解析,希望对您选择合适的同步工具有所帮助,在实际应用中,应根据业务需求和预算选择合适的数据库同步工具,以确保数据安全、高效地同步。
标签: #数据库同步工具
评论列表